How to fill out the syllabus form Westchester Community College online
Filling out the syllabus form for Westchester Community College is an essential task for course originators and revisors. This guide will provide clear, step-by-step instructions to help users complete the form accurately and efficiently, ensuring all necessary details are included.
Follow the steps to successfully complete the syllabus form.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the syllabus form. This will allow you to open the document in an online editor.
- Begin by filling out the course number in the designated field. Ensure the number accurately reflects the course being offered.
- Enter your name as the originator or reviser of the course in the 'Name of originator/revisor' field.
- Provide the complete name of the course in the 'Name of course' section, ensuring it matches institutional guidelines.
- Indicate the current semester and year in the 'Current date' field.
- Specify whether this is a new course or a revision by checking the appropriate box.
- Fill in the date of the prior revision, if applicable, to maintain accurate records.
- Complete the fields for the number of credits and the number of contact hours per week, making sure they align with institutional policies.
- Outline the frequency of the course offering by selecting from the available options.
- List any prerequisites or entry-level skills required for the course to assist students in understanding requirements.
- Indicate if there are any corequisites for the course by checking the corresponding box.
- Describe the place of the course within the curriculum, ensuring to check the relevant categories.
- Answer whether the course is designed for transfer toward a specific major, providing the major name if applicable.
- List the course outcomes in detail, describing what students will learn and how these will be measured.
- Outline the grading criteria, including participation, projects, exams, and homework.
- Specify instructional methods that will be applied throughout the course, highlighting any supplementary learning options.
- Provide details on cross-curricular opportunities, addressing general education enrichment, information management, critical thinking, and student engagement.
- Complete the topic outline by listing required chapters as per departmental guidelines.
- Note any unique aspects of the course, including specific equipment or software requirements.
- List all required texts and supplementary materials in the appropriate appendix sections.
- Conclude by drafting a catalog description of the course, keeping it concise under 65 words.
- Finally, review your entries for accuracy, save any changes made, and utilize the options to download, print, or share the completed form.
